Solution Overview
Problem
Conventional approaches require users to manually configure and format their data to be indexed for network-based storage and search services, which can be inconvenient and cumbersome, reducing the user experience.
Innovation Solution
A network service automatically analyzes uploaded data to determine data field types and enables appropriate search options, generating an index configuration and search index without user instruction, allowing for efficient data indexing and storage.

An entity using a computing device can upload searchable data to a network service to be indexed and stored. The data can include a plurality of data fields, each data field having one or more associated values. The network service can analyze the data fields and their respectively associated values to determine data field types for the data fields and search options to be enabled for the data fields. Based at least in part on the data field types and the search options, the network service can generate a search index configuration/schema. Based at least in part on the generated search index configuration/schema, the network service can generate a search index for the data. In some embodiments, the network service can also convert the data into a format compatible with the search index.
